My first recommendation is obviously Greek.
Its a sweet red wine, with a taste that can only be comparable to a nice bottle of port(which really is my drink of choice) it comes in at a reasonable £4.77 a bottle in Asda.
Lovely easy drink, chilled, sweet, with a raisin taste, that lingers marvellously.........but a warning, drinking the whole bottle will give one stinking hangover
Mavrodaphne of Patras. To clarify, only for those who take a liking to Port.
